Top 5 Shoot'em Up Games on Android in Latvia Q3 2021

The third quarter of 2021 saw interesting trends in the performance of the top 5 shoot'em up games on the Android platform in Latvia. Here's a closer look at how these games fared in terms of weekly downloads and revenue.

Archero experienced fluctuating weekly revenue, peaking at around $160 in early July and closing the quarter with a revenue of $88. Weekly downloads also varied, with a notable spike to 129 in the last week of July and tapering off to 65 by the end of September.

Azur Lane showed a strong upward trend in revenue, starting from $53 in late June and surging to $252 by the end of September. Downloads followed a similar pattern, with a significant rise from 155 in late June to a peak of 300 in mid-September, before settling at 271 by the quarter's end.

Mr Autofire had a steady increase in both revenue and downloads. Revenue peaked at $112 in mid-September, while weekly downloads saw a consistent rise, reaching 290 by the end of the quarter.

Space shooter - Galaxy attack maintained a steady revenue stream, with notable peaks of $107 in late July and $100 in early September. Downloads steadily increased, culminating at 121 in the final week of September.

Finally, Tank Hero - Awesome tank war g had a more volatile performance. Revenue peaked at $91 in early July but dropped to $8 by the end of September. Downloads were relatively low, peaking at 34 in mid-July and decreasing to 14 by the quarter's end.

These insights are based on data from Sensor Tower, where more detailed information can be found.
